6x^+4(x^-1) simply this question

1. when you see 4(x² - 1), then you have to multiply 4 with everything in the bracket. keep in mind that you always have to be cautious of the sign whether it is a positive or a negative.

positive ×/÷ positive = positive
negative ×/÷ negative = positive
positive ×/÷ negative = negative
negative ×/÷ positive = negative

^ you have to remember this.

2. only like terms (same alphabet) can plus or minus each other.

3. simplify by taking out the common factor and placing it outside the bracket. though, keep in mind that you also have to divide the terms inside the bracket by the common factor.

Which point is not on the graph of the equation y=10+x
SCORPION-xisa [38]

Answer:

C

Step-by-step explanation:

Check all points:

A: x=0, y=10, then from the equality 10=10+0 follows that A lies on the line.

B: x=3, y=13, then from the equality 13=10+3 follows that B lies on the line.

C: x=8, y=2, then from the inequality 2=10+8 follows that C doesn't lie on the line.

D: x=5, y=15, then from the equality 15=10+5 follows that D lies on the line.
